Answer:

The slope is [tex]-\frac{1}{3}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

Use the slope formula:

[tex]\frac{rise}{run} = \frac{y_{2}-y_{1} }{x_{2}-x_{1}}[/tex]

With [tex]y_{2}[/tex] being 4 and [tex]y_{1}[/tex] being 2

And [tex]x_{2}[/tex] being -3 and [tex]x_{1}[/tex] being 3

You would set it up like this:

[tex]\frac{(4)-(2)}{(-3)-(3)}[/tex]  which would equal [tex]-\frac{2}{6}[/tex]  or [tex]-\frac{1}{3}[/tex]
